A 3-pack of jump ropes costs $6.90. What is the unit price?

Mathematics
2 answers:
polet [3.4K]3 years ago
4 0

Answer:

$2.30 for each jump rope.

Step-by-step explanation:

6.90 / 3 = 2.3

Determine if the given differential equation is exact (e^2y-y cos xy)dx+(2xe^2 y-cos xy+2y)dy=0
rewona [7]
\dfrac\partial{\partial y}\left[e^{2y}-y\cos xy\right]=2e^{2y}-\cos xy+xy\sin xy

\dfrac\partial{\partial x}\left[2xe^{2y}-y\cos xy+2y\right]=2e^{2y}+y\sin xy

The partial derivatives are not equal, so the equation is not exact.
